The Hunger Games
I am reading the Hunger Games by Suzanne Collins. I started reading this book on Monday and I am already on page 250. It is so good that I cannot put it down when I start reading it!! It's about this girl who is entered into the Hunger Games. Those are when 24 people ages 12-18 are put into an arena and are forced to kill each other until there is one person remaining. There are two "tributes" from each district. There are 12 districts and they make up the country. Its kind of a sick idea (kids killing each other) but its because they want to live and it's a really good idea for a book. The main character is good at hunting and knife throwing and she can take care of herself well. She pairs up with a 12 years old who reminds her of her younger sister. They make a good team.

Boy Tales of Childhood
Boy Tales of Childhood is a super funny biography of the life of Roald Dahl growing up. It talks mostly about the adventures that he has and what he does. Things like almost getting his nose cut off in an accident, having the headmistress at his school shove soap down a boys throat for snoring, having gotten his adenoids out without any medicine, and many more hilarious stories. But there are also more serious stories like him traveling to places and him moving and transferring schools.
I like this book mostly because it is just extremely funny. Also because Roald Dahl gets all (well most) of his ideas from experiences that happened in his life. This is so cool to me because that means that Charlie and the Chocolate Factory was based off the idea of him being a candy tester/taster for Cadbury's. Which did actually happen when he was younger.
